Conversion Formula for Decinewton to Meganewton
Conversion from decinewton to meganewton is a simple process once you know the basic relationship between the two units. One Decinewton is equal to 0.0000001 Meganewton, while one Meganewton contains 10,000,000 Decinewton.
To change a measurement from decinewton to meganewton, you only need to multiply the number of decinewton by 0.0000001.
1 Decinewton = 0.0000001 Meganewton
1 Meganewton = 10,000,000 Decinewton

Decinewton (Tenth of a Newton)
Introduction : The decinewton is equal to one-tenth of a newton (0.1 N), making it suitable for measuring small-scale forces with more intuitive values. It helps bridge the gap between a newton and more granular units like millinewtons in precision instrumentation.
History & Origin : As part of the SI system’s decimal-based structure, the decinewton was formalized to support accurate measurements in systems using standard metric prefixes. Though not widely used in daily practice, it’s recognized for educational, scientific, and metrology applications.
Current Use : Decinewtons are commonly used in educational settings, physics labs, and low-force engineering calculations. They provide a manageable way to express forces slightly below one newton, such as the force needed to press light buttons or delicate mechanical devices.
Meganewton (High Magnitude Force)
Introduction : The meganewton represents one million newtons and is used in industries where extremely high forces occur, such as aerospace, rocketry, and deep-sea construction.
History & Origin : Meganewtons emerged from the need to express large-scale forces during the development of space exploration and heavy machinery. It helped standardize discussions around launch thrust and earth-moving equipment.
Current Use : Common in spaceflight to describe engine thrust—e.g., the Saturn V rocket produced over 34 MN. Also used in geotechnical and civil engineering for major load-bearing structures like dams and towers.
